ABSTRACT:
A protective shutter assembly for a fan of a forced air cooling system includes lightweight shutter members mounted for pivoting motion about vertical axes. When the fan is operative, its shutter members are pivoted in a first direction to expose the fan and allow air to be exhausted therefrom. When a fan is inoperative, its shutter members pivot in a second direction toward the fan and overlap to prevent air from being reversely drawn into the fan.
